Crystal Bay boasts picturesque landscapes with soft sandy beaches framed by lush hills and striking rock formations. The combination of breathtaking views and rich marine life makes Crystal Bay a must-visit for anyone looking to explore the underwater beauty of Nusa PenidaThe bay is sheltered, creating calm conditions that are perfect for snorkelers of all skill levels. As you enter the water, you're greeted by a rich underwater ecosystem filled with colorful coral reefs and an array of tropical fish, making it a vibrant and lively underwater paradise.

2

Gamat Bay in Nusa Penida is a gorgeous snorkeling spot. The bay is home to vibrant coral reefs teeming with diverse marine life, including colorful fish, sea turtles, and various invertebrates. The clear, calm waters provide good visibility, making it easy for snorkelers to appreciate the underwater beauty. With the bay's gentle waves, the shallow areas allow for easy exploration, ensuring that visitors can enjoy the rich marine ecosystem

Manta Bay is known for its crystal-clear waters, where you'll be captivated by the vibrant coral reefs teeming with diverse marine species. The underwater ecosystem is a heaven for colorful fish, starfish, and other sea creatures. In addition to the remarkable marine life, the stunning scenery above water adds to the experience. Manta Bay is framed by dramatic cliffs and lush greenery, providing a breathtaking contrast to the azure sea. Whether you're floating on the surface or exploring below, the combination of vibrant sea life and picturesque surroundings makes snorkeling at Manta Bay a truly unforgettable experience.

4
Stop 4

Kelingking Beach is known for its dramatic cliffs that resemble a T-Rex's head, with the beach's features striking turquoise waters and white sandy shores. Accessing Kelingking Beach involves a steep trek down a rocky path, which can be challenging but is rewarding for those who make the descent. The rugged coastline creates a stunning backdrop, making it a favorite spot for photographers and nature lovers alike.

5

Broken Beach is known for its stunning natural beauty. This beach features a large rock formation with a circular hole that allows the ocean to flow through, creating a admireable dramatic scenery, and it's a popular destination for those seeking breathtaking views and a tranquil escape.

About Kuta

Kuta is a vibrant coastal town in Bali, renowned for its stunning beaches, world-class surfing, and lively nightlife. It's a perfect blend of natural beauty, adventure, and cultural experiences, making it a top destination for travelers seeking both relaxation and excitement.

Best Time to Visit

April to September

The best time to visit Kuta is during the dry season when the weather is sunny and ideal for beach activities, surfing, and exploring the outdoors. This is also the peak tourist season, offering the most vibrant atmosphere and a wide range of events.

Safety Information

Overall Safety Rating: Generally safe

Kuta is generally safe for tourists, but petty crime and scams can occur. Be cautious of your surroundings, especially in crowded areas and at night.

Important Precautions:
  • • Use reputable tour operators and taxi services.
  • • Keep valuables secure and out of sight.
  • • Be cautious of strangers offering unsolicited help or services.
